Phytochemical screening, acute toxicity and anti-anaemic activity of aqueous and hydroethanolic extracts of Adenia lobata leaves

Abstract:

The active ingredients contained in the aqueous and hydroethanolic extracts of Adenia lobata was extracted used to conduct a toxicity study and evaluation of the anti-anemic activity of these extracts in anemic- induced rats. The dry powder of Adenia lobata was extracted with water (100g/L) for the aqueous extract and in a 70% hydroethanolic solution (ethanol/water 70:30) for the preparation of the hydroethanolic extract. The secondary metabolites contained in the different extracts were identified by thin layer chromatography. Acute oral toxicity was assessed according to the method of the Organization for Economic Cooperation and Development 423. Anemia was induced in rats by intraperitoneal administration of 40 mg/kg/d of phenylhydrazine for two days (J0 and J1) and these anemic rats were treated with extracts of Adenia lobata and vitamin B12. Adenia lobata extracts are rich in secondary metabolites such as flavonoids, alkaloids, polyterpenes but poor in quinone. The plant is non-toxic to the body because its LD50 is greater than 5000 mg/Kg per body weight. The aqueous and hydroethanolic extracts of Adenia lobata normalize the hematological parameters of anemic rats. Adenia lobata could be a solution for cures of anemia encountered in children and pregnant women.
